The situation described where the owner of Bob's Tire and Oil decides to open a pizza restaurant next to the repair shop represents unrelated diversification. This is because the automotive repair business and a pizza restaurant operate in completely different industries with distinct value chains. Unlike horizontal integration where a company expands within the same industry, or vertical integration where a company expands into different stages of the same value chain, unrelated diversification sees a company branching out into an entirely new line of business.
